site stats

Direct recursion vs indirect recursion

WebThe code used to develop my web application. Run the log.html file to initialise the project. - Final_year_project/recursion.html at main · stephaniedeegan/Final ... WebIndirect Recursion A method calling itself is direct recursion, but a sequence of methods that eventually calls the first can result in indirectrecursion. This is often difficult to understand and debug. A higher-level recursive method with subroutine method calls can avoid this confusion.

Baeldung on LinkedIn: Recursion: Direct vs Indirect Baeldung …

WebJan 1, 2024 · Types of Recursion (Part 1) Direct & Indirect Recursion - YouTube 0:00 / 9:45 Types of Recursion (Part 1) Direct & Indirect Recursion Neso Academy 2.02M subscribers Join Subscribe 3.7K... WebMar 31, 2024 · What is the difference between direct and indirect recursion? A function fun is called direct recursive if it calls the same function fun. A function fun is called indirect recursive if it calls another function say … haydon matthew https://ifixfonesrx.com

Recursion.txt - Infinite Recursion Base Case: Every recursive ...

WebWhen the function calls directly itself, and the function is independent to do it, this is a direct recursion. Indirect Recursion. When a function depends on another function (mutual function call) to call itself, it receives the name of indirect recursion. Tail Recursive Method and Infinite Recursion WebThis lesson explains two different types of recursion: direct and indirect recursion. WebOct 23, 2024 · What is the difference between direct and indirect recursion? A function fun is called direct recursive if it calls the same function fun. A function fun is called indirect recursive if it calls another … haydon materials.com

Dynamic Programming Vs. Recursion: What Is The Difference?

Category:Dynamic Programming Vs. Recursion: What Is The Difference?

Tags:Direct recursion vs indirect recursion

Direct recursion vs indirect recursion

Recursion basics PDF Computer Engineering Computer …

WebRecursion basics - View presentation slides online. Useful document outlining the basics of recursion. Useful document outlining the basics of recursion. Recursion basics. Uploaded by Evan Chauhan. 0 ratings 0% found this document useful (0 votes) 0 views. 24 pages. Document Information

Direct recursion vs indirect recursion

Did you know?

WebOn the other hand, recursion has the following advantages: For a recursive function, you only need to define the base case and recursive case, so the code is simpler and shorter than an iterative code. Some problems are inherently … Web3Types of recursion Toggle Types of recursion subsection 3.1Single recursion and multiple recursion 3.2Indirect recursion 3.3Anonymous recursion 3.4Structural versus generative recursion 4Implementation issues Toggle Implementation issues subsection 4.1Wrapper function 4.2Short-circuiting the base case 4.2.1Depth-first search

WebMatch the following: Direct recursion Indirect recursion Infinite recursion Tail recursion Recursive Function Recursive Helper Function means that a function directly invokes … WebOct 27, 2024 · Indirect recursion is almost always regarded as a severe bug. As for why (indirect) recursion exists... Back in the 1960s and 1970s new up-coming programming languages competed over having the most (useless) features. Programming was a brand new thing and nobody actually knew which features that would actually become useful …

WebDirect vs. Indirect Recursion. This lesson explains two different types of recursion: direct and indirect recursion. We'll cover the following. Direct Recursion. The Base Case. … WebFollowing are the types of the recursion in C programming language, as follows: Direct Recursion; Indirect Recursion; Tail Recursion; No Tail/ Head Recursion; Linear …

WebMar 18, 2024 · In the direct recursion, only one function is called by itself. In indirect recursion more than one function are by the other function and number of times. direct …

WebFeb 9, 2024 · The indirect recursion does not make any overhead as direct recursion. The direct recursion called by the same function while the indirect function called by the other function. In direct function, when function called next time, value of local variable will stored but in indirect recursion, value will automatically lost when any other function ... haydon mayer nursing homeWebFeb 20, 2024 · In this program, you have a method named fun that calls itself again in its function body. Thus, you can say that it is direct recursive. Indirect Recursion; The … haydon parish neighbourhood planWebJul 24, 2024 · Direct recursion occurs when a method calls itself such, as the fact function invoking fact again. long f () { ... f (); } Indirect recursion occurs when a chain of method calls eventually led to the calling of the original method again. long f () { g (); } long g () { h (); } long h () { f (); } botox abilene txWebSep 7, 2013 · We call a function to recognize each of those, so when we're recognizing an expression in parentheses as a term, we use indirect recursion -- expression () -> product () -> term () -> expression (). Share Improve this answer Follow answered Sep 7, 2013 at 19:12 Jerry Coffin 468k 79 621 1100 Add a comment 2 haydon newsWebLet us trace the above example step by step for a better understanding of how the Indirect Recursion works. Step1: Output: 12 Tracing Tree: In the above example, we call fun1 … haydon mfg co antique clock motor gearsWebMar 31, 2024 · In the direct recursion, only one function is called by itself. In indirect recursion more than one function are by the other function and number of times. direct recursion makes overhead. The indirect … botox abbvieWebDec 14, 2024 · A function might use both direct and indirect recursion in the same function definition and then it would do both. Direct is always that it calls itself explicitly while indirect is where it doesn't look like recursion but eventually flow can lead back to the original function. botox abingdon